Output bfaa348500aebfd970efb0626d6705d3fb5365bfb9709ea4d0e1be57ac131ccb:1

value
44911933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 120d6e6780be334d8631396f56de106f24600ce8 OP_EQUAL
address
33LUBDZrq4o3vDW6H12zeppMXJY9Hb7Qd2
transaction
bfaa348500aebfd970efb0626d6705d3fb5365bfb9709ea4d0e1be57ac131ccb
confirmations
3626
spent
false